When web-hosting company Glitch.com shut down overnight, dozens of playful self-made sites from our past workshops vanished, replaced by the error screen “Well. You found a glitch.” All that remains are tiny thumbnail previews we rescued onto an Are.na board, like digital fossils of a lost web.

In this hands-on session, we’ll revive those dead pages: Decode the previews: inspect colours, layouts, images and GIFs to reverse-engineer each site’s vibe. Re-build from scratch: use HTML, CSS and basic JavaScript

This workshop is suitable for beginners to intermediate coding! Make sure to bring your laptop to turn lost internet rubble into a fresh, living webpage, and leave with your own ‘undead’ URL to share.

Organised by Phreaking Collective as part of an series of talks and workshops accompanying BitRot, an exhibition exploring the fragility, decay, and obsolescence of our digital age. Taking its name from the slow degradation of digital files over time, Bit Rot stages a post-human reflection on the technologies that once promised progress and the lives they now leave behind.
